Hiroyuki Takamatsu is a scholar working on Hematology, Molecular Biology and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Hiroyuki Takamatsu has authored 141 papers receiving a total of 2.4k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 64 papers in Hematology, 46 papers in Molecular Biology and 32 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Hiroyuki Takamatsu’s work include Multiple Myeloma Research and Treatments (40 papers),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ation (25 papers) and Pain Mechanisms and Treatments (15 papers). Hiroyuki Takamatsu is often cited by papers focused on Multiple Myeloma Research and Treatments (40 papers),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ation (25 papers) and Pain Mechanisms and Treatments (15 papers). Hiroyuki Takamatsu collaborates with scholars based in Japan, United States and Egypt. Hiroyuki Takamatsu's co-authors include Akira Kudō, Hidehiro Ozawa, Lynda F. Bonewald, Mieko Katsuura, Keisuke Horiuchi, Norio Amizuka, Sunao Takeshita, Yoshiaki Toyama, Shintaro Nishimura and Shinji Nakao and has published in prestigious journals such as Angewandte Chemie International Edition, Journal of Clinical Oncology and Blood.
